Telegraph Quartet to Present Robert Sirota and Stevan Cavalier’s ‘Contrapassos’

By Logan Martell

On February 6, 2022, Telegraph Quartet will present the world premiere of composer Robert Sirota and librettist Stevan Cavalier’s “Contrapassos.”

Commissioned by the Sierra Chamber Society, this new work was originally meant to premiere in March 2020 as part of Sirota@70, a celebration of the company’s 70th anniversary. The concert will see the new work presented along with Beethoven’s “String Quartet No. 15 in A minor, Op. 132” and Schoenberg’s “String Quartet No. 2 Op. 10” for soprano and string quartet.

The premiere performance will be held at the Grace Presbyterian Church in San Francisco, the concert will feature soprano Abigail Fischer, accompanied by the quartet. Subsequent performances will be held on Feb. 8 at Old St. Mary’s Cathedral, and Feb. 10 at the San Francisco Conservatory of Music.

“As a composer, I have found that my best work invariably emerges from the fabric of relationships with others,” Sirota said in an official statement. “I am fond of saying that I don’t compose pieces so much for instruments or voices, as for specific people… Add to this that I have known the great soprano Abigail Fischer literally since before she was born, and you have the perfect alignment of relationships and collaborations.”
